Forest Park
Forest Park has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$30,987. Population has declined 14% since 2000. 5%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 28%. Median home value is $98,500. At a median age of 31.4,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. Households here earn about 37% less than the Georgia median.

How many people live in Forest Park, Georgia?
Forest Park, Georgia has about 18,468 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Forest Park, Georgia?
The typical household in Forest Park, Georgia earns about $30,987 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Forest Park, Georgia expensive?
In Forest Park, Georgia, the median home is worth about $98,500, and the typical rent is about $825 a month.
How educated are people in Forest Park, Georgia?
About 5.2% of adults age 25 and over in Forest Park, Georgia h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Forest Park, Georgia?
About 37.6% of people in Forest Park, Georgia live below the federal poverty line.
Has Forest Park, Georgia grown since 1990?
Yes, Forest Park, Georgia has grown since 1990. The population has added about 1,543 residents, a change of about 9 percent over that period.
